## Environments — Quillrate Tax Cache

The Quillrate service caches jurisdiction tax rates for checkout. There are three environments: sandbox (synthetic rates, safe for experiments), staging (nightly snapshot of production rates), and production (live data, change-controlled). Contractors receive sandbox access by default; staging requires a lead's approval. Rates refresh on a schedule that differs per environment, so do not compare values across them directly. The staging environment currently runs with the configuration values listed below.

settings of fadup-kajog:
[casox]
port = 3000
team = jorix
host = casox.paliqio.example
region = lower-4
access_code = ac_dd069a
timeout_ms = 750

Retail Pilot: Norvale Stores — Manager Wiki (Restricted)

Overview for sales leads. The Kestrel checkout terminals are now live in six Norvale Stores locations across the Ashbourne district. Early metrics: basket-scan times down 18%, staff training time within target. Norvale's merchandising team wants co-branded signage before any expansion talks. Do not discuss rollout scope with store managers until the framework agreement is signed. Current thinking on next steps is summarised below.

confidential, hadup-yaguf: Briielox Systems plans to raise the Holax list price by 5 percent in July.

## Authentication

The `extract-strings` script pulls translatable strings from the Lumenvale frontend repos and pushes them to the Phrasebarn service. On-call engineers should only run this manually when the nightly job fails. The script authenticates against Phrasebarn's internal API gateway; without valid credentials it exits silently with code 3, which is easy to miss in logs, so always check the exit status. Export the variable before invoking the script. Use the key below for authentication.

gateway credential: kto23_LX9A4ys6i4nzHtpOLNLodKK

Handover — Brinnock formula sandbox

Taking over from last week: user-supplied formulas in Brinnock run inside the sandbox pool with CPU and memory caps enforced per evaluation. We tightened the caps Tuesday after a runaway recursion incident; error rates have been flat since. If the sandbox queue backs up, restart the pool workers one at a time, not all at once. The sandbox pool currently runs with the following configuration.

service settings:
[casax]
port = 6379
team = rusir
host = casax.zemvarhq.corp
region = outer-4
access_code = ac_9808ce
timeout_ms = 1500